rpms/aqsis/F-12 aqsis.spec,1.17,1.18
Nicolas Chauvet
kwizart at fedoraproject.org
Mon Oct 19 20:49:52 UTC 2009
Author: kwizart
Update of /cvs/pkgs/rpms/aqsis/F-12
In directory cvs1.fedora.phx.redhat.com:/tmp/cvs-serv11205/F-12
Modified Files:
aqsis.spec
Log Message:
- Minor updates to SPEC file by Leon Tony Atkinson - <latkinson at aqsis.org>
Index: aqsis.spec
===================================================================
RCS file: /cvs/pkgs/rpms/aqsis/F-12/aqsis.spec,v
retrieving revision 1.17
retrieving revision 1.18
diff -u -p -r1.17 -r1.18
--- aqsis.spec 19 Oct 2009 19:33:51 -0000 1.17
+++ aqsis.spec 19 Oct 2009 20:49:51 -0000 1.18
@@ -1,7 +1,7 @@
Name: aqsis
Version: 1.6.0
Release: 1%{?dist}
-Summary: Open source RenderMan-compliant 3D rendering solution
+Summary: Open source 3D rendering solution adhering to the RenderMan standard
Group: Applications/Multimedia
License: GPLv2+ and LGPLv2+
@@ -13,7 +13,7 @@ BuildRequires: desktop-file-utils
BuildRequires: bison >= 1.35.0
BuildRequires: boost-devel >= 1.34.0
-BuildRequires: cmake >= 2.4.6
+BuildRequires: cmake >= 2.6.3
BuildRequires: flex >= 2.5.4
BuildRequires: fltk-devel >= 1.1.0, fltk-fluid
BuildRequires: libjpeg-devel >= 6
@@ -28,45 +28,53 @@ Requires: aqsis-data = %{version}-%{rele
%description
-Aqsis is a cross-platform photorealistic 3D rendering solution, based
-on the RenderMan interface standard defined by Pixar Animation Studios.
+Aqsis is a cross-platform photorealistic 3D rendering solution,
+adhering to the RenderMan interface standard defined by Pixar
+Animation Studios.
-This package contains a command-line renderer, a shader compiler for shaders
-written using the RenderMan shading language, a texture pre-processor for
-optimizing textures and a RIB processor.
+This package contains graphical utilities and desktop integration.
%package core
Requires: %{name}-libs = %{version}-%{release}
-Summary: Core binaries for Aqsis
+Summary: Command-line tools for Aqsis Renderer
Group: Applications/Multimedia
%description core
-Aqsis is a cross-platform photorealistic 3D rendering solution, based
-on the RenderMan interface standard defined by Pixar Animation Studios.
-
-This package contains the core binaries for aqsis.
+Aqsis is a cross-platform photorealistic 3D rendering solution,
+adhering to the RenderMan interface standard defined by Pixar
+Animation Studios.
+
+This package contains a command-line renderer, a shader compiler
+for shaders written using the RenderMan shading language, a texture
+pre-processor for optimizing textures and a RIB processor.
%package libs
-Summary: Libraries for %{name}
+Summary: Library files for Aqsis Renderer
Group: System Environment/Libraries
%description libs
-The %{name}-libs package contains shared libraries for %{name}.
+Aqsis is a cross-platform photorealistic 3D rendering solution,
+adhering to the RenderMan interface standard defined by Pixar
+Animation Studios.
+
+This package contains the shared libraries for Aqsis Renderer.
%package data
Requires: %{name} = %{version}-%{release}
-Summary: Example content for Aqsis
+Summary: Example content for Aqsis Renderer
Group: Applications/Multimedia
BuildArch: noarch
%description data
-Aqsis is a cross-platform photorealistic 3D rendering solution, based
-on the RenderMan interface standard defined by Pixar Animation Studios.
+Aqsis is a cross-platform photorealistic 3D rendering solution,
+adhering to the RenderMan interface standard defined by Pixar
+Animation Studios.
-This package contains example content, including additional scenes and shaders.
+This package contains example content, including additional
+scenes, procedurals and shaders.
%package devel
@@ -74,15 +82,16 @@ Requires: %{name} = %{version}-%{release
Requires: aqsis-core = %{version}-%{release}
Requires: aqsis-libs = %{version}-%{release}
Requires: aqsis-data = %{version}-%{release}
-Summary: Development files for Aqsis
+Summary: Development files for Aqsis Renderer
Group: Development/Libraries
%description devel
-Aqsis is a cross-platform photorealistic 3D rendering solution, based
-on the RenderMan interface standard defined by Pixar Animation Studios.
+Aqsis is a cross-platform photorealistic 3D rendering solution,
+adhering to the RenderMan interface standard defined by Pixar
+Animation Studios.
-This package contains various developer libraries to enable integration with
-third-party applications.
+This package contains various developer libraries to enable
+integration with third-party applications.
%prep
@@ -96,14 +105,10 @@ rm -rf build
mkdir -p build
pushd build
%cmake \
- -DSYSCONFDIR:STRING=%{_sysconfdir}/aqsis \
- -DSCRIPTSDIR=share/aqsis/scripts \
+ -DSYSCONFDIR:STRING=%{_sysconfdir}/%{name} \
-DAQSIS_MAIN_CONFIG_NAME=aqsisrc-%{_lib} \
-%if %{?_lib} == "lib64"
-DLIBDIR=%{_lib} \
- -DDEFAULT_PLUGIN_PATH="%{_lib}/aqsis" \
- -DPLUGINDIR=%{_lib}/aqsis/plugins \
-%endif
+ -DPLUGINDIR=%{_lib}/%{name} \
-DCMAKE_VERBOSE_MAKEFILE:BOOL=ON \
-DCMAKE_SKIP_RPATH:BOOL=ON \
-DAQSIS_USE_RPATH:BOOL=OFF \
@@ -124,10 +129,6 @@ pushd build
make install DESTDIR=$RPM_BUILD_ROOT
popd
-# Move aqsisrc
-mv $RPM_BUILD_ROOT%{_sysconfdir}/%{name}/aqsisrc \
- $RPM_BUILD_ROOT%{_sysconfdir}/%{name}/aqsisrc-%{_lib}
-
desktop-file-install --vendor "" --delete-original \
--dir $RPM_BUILD_ROOT%{_datadir}/applications \
$RPM_BUILD_ROOT%{_datadir}/applications/aqsis.desktop
@@ -149,7 +150,6 @@ desktop-file-install --vendor "" --delet
$RPM_BUILD_ROOT%{_datadir}/applications/piqsl.desktop
-
%clean
rm -rf $RPM_BUILD_ROOT
@@ -235,6 +235,9 @@ fi || :
%changelog
+* Mon Oct 19 2009 kwizart < kwizart at gmail.com > - 1.6.0-2
+- Minor updates to SPEC file by Leon Tony Atkinson - <latkinson at aqsis.org>
+
* Sat Oct 17 2009 kwizart < kwizart at gmail.com > - 1.6.0-1
- Update to 1.6.0
More information about the fedora-extras-commits
mailing list